Japan calls up strongest squad to play Vietnam at Asian Cup 2023

VTC NewsVTC News01/01/2024


Japan is the first opponent of the Vietnamese team in the 2023 Asian Cup. The number 1 team in Asia has just announced a list of 26 players participating in the 2023 Asian Cup, including all the biggest stars who are in good form in the top European leagues.

The current Japanese team lineup has some changes compared to the 2022 World Cup as well as the last time they faced the Vietnamese team nearly 2 years ago. "Veterans" such as Yuto Nagatomo, Shuichi Gonda, Hiroki Sakai are no longer present.

However, the team nicknamed "Blue Samurai" is still very strong with the remaining stars. Wataru Endo (Liverpool), Takehiro Tomiyasu (Arsenal) have both affirmed their abilities in the Premier League. Takefusa Kubo played impressively at Real Sociedad.

The most notable name in the Japanese team is Kaoru Mitoma - the phenomenon of the Premier League last season. The Brighton player is injured but he is still called up by coach Hajime Moriyasu. This coach still hopes Mitoma can recover in time.

Recently, the Japanese team just won 5-0 against Thailand in a friendly match at home. Notably, coach Moriyasu did not use his strongest lineup.

Japan's form in 2023 is excellent. They are on a 9-match unbeaten streak. The only match in which Japan scored less than 4 goals was a 2-0 win over Tunisia. In the last 4 matches, the "Blue Samurai" have not conceded a single goal.

Compared to the Vietnamese team, Japan is at a superior level. Winning points against this opponent in the opening match of the 2023 Asian Cup is very difficult for coach Philippe Troussier and his team.

Japan squad for Asian Cup 2023

Goalkeepers: Daiya Maekawa, Zion Suzuki and Taishi Brandon Nozawa

Defenders: Shogo Taniguchi, Ko Itakura, Tsuyoshi Watanabe, Yuta Nakayama, Koki Machida, Seiya Maikuma, Takehiro Tomiyasu, Hiroki Ito and Yukinari Sugawara

Midfielders: Wataru Endo, Junya Ito, Takuma Asano, Hidemasa Morita, Kaoru Mitoma, Daizen Maeda, Reo Hatate, Kaishi Sano

Forwards: Ritsu Doan, Ayase Ueda, Keito Nakamura, Takefusa Kubo, Takumi Minamino and Mao Hosoya
